diff options
author | rillig <rillig> | 2005-11-10 10:26:46 +0000 |
---|---|---|
committer | rillig <rillig> | 2005-11-10 10:26:46 +0000 |
commit | b7669382ccf1f4ba4b073b3774607c6169e8a665 (patch) | |
tree | 76f4f786351ac2eab50b802068dd0c1411427b00 /pkgtools | |
parent | 32c8fbbdb43d05b9e987f8fcbf1bac083fd5fb96 (diff) | |
download | pkgsrc-b7669382ccf1f4ba4b073b3774607c6169e8a665.tar.gz |
Updated pkglint to 4.38.4.
- Improved detection of valid tool names.
- In the post-install target, output does to stderr instead of stdout.
Diffstat (limited to 'pkgtools')
-rw-r--r-- | pkgtools/pkglint/Makefile | 6 | ||||
-rw-r--r-- | pkgtools/pkglint/files/pkglint.pl | 6 |
2 files changed, 6 insertions, 6 deletions
diff --git a/pkgtools/pkglint/Makefile b/pkgtools/pkglint/Makefile index 0c6b381c1e8..db76f9548bb 100644 --- a/pkgtools/pkglint/Makefile +++ b/pkgtools/pkglint/Makefile @@ -1,7 +1,7 @@ -# $NetBSD: Makefile,v 1.289 2005/11/08 23:05:22 rillig Exp $ +# $NetBSD: Makefile,v 1.290 2005/11/10 10:26:46 rillig Exp $ # -DISTNAME= pkglint-4.38.3 +DISTNAME= pkglint-4.38.4 CATEGORIES= pkgtools devel MASTER_SITES= # empty DISTFILES= # empty @@ -60,6 +60,6 @@ do-install: ${INSTALL_DATA} ${FILESDIR}/deprecated.map ${PREFIX}/share/pkglint/ post-install: - ${PREFIX}/bin/pkglint -q + ${PREFIX}/bin/pkglint -q 1>&2 .include "../../mk/bsd.pkg.mk" diff --git a/pkgtools/pkglint/files/pkglint.pl b/pkgtools/pkglint/files/pkglint.pl index d68e6e04ab3..174c1152f6a 100644 --- a/pkgtools/pkglint/files/pkglint.pl +++ b/pkgtools/pkglint/files/pkglint.pl @@ -11,7 +11,7 @@ # Freely redistributable. Absolutely no warranty. # # From Id: portlint.pl,v 1.64 1998/02/28 02:34:05 itojun Exp -# $NetBSD: pkglint.pl,v 1.342 2005/11/10 07:46:24 rillig Exp $ +# $NetBSD: pkglint.pl,v 1.343 2005/11/10 10:26:46 rillig Exp $ # # This version contains lots of changes necessary for NetBSD packages # done by: @@ -1461,7 +1461,7 @@ sub get_tool_names() { } my $tools = {}; - foreach my $file (qw(autoconf automake ldconfig make replace rpcgen texinfo)) { + foreach my $file (qw(autoconf automake defaults ldconfig make replace rpcgen texinfo)) { my $fname = "${pkgsrcdir}/mk/tools/${file}.mk"; my $lines = load_lines($fname, true); @@ -1475,7 +1475,7 @@ sub get_tool_names() { my ($varname, undef, $value, undef) = ($1, $2, $3, $4); if ($varname eq "TOOLS_CREATE" && $value =~ qr"^([-\w.]+)$") { $tools->{$value} = true; - } elsif ($varname =~ qr"^TOOLS_PATH\.([-\w.]+)$") { + } elsif ($varname =~ qr"^(?:TOOLS_PATH|_TOOLS_VARNAME)\.([-\w.]+)$") { $tools->{$1} = true; } } |